Jeb Dunnuck: A Merlot-heavy blend of 87% Merlot and 13% Cabernet Franc that will spend 15 months in 65% new French oak, the 2025 Château Feytit Clinet is just brilliant, with a full-bodied, deep, and layered profile packed with blue and black fruits, chocolate, and tobacco. On the palate, it's concentrated and powerful yet stays weightless and flawlessly balanced, with velvety tannins and a great finish. Hitting 14% alcohol, this is up with the crème de la crème of the Right Bank, as well as Bordeaux in general."

The Wine Cellar Insider: Violets, licorice, truffle, licorice, smoke, black cherries, and chocolate create the perfume. Polished, plush, fresh, and creamy, the wine is packed with ripe, sweet, energetic fruits, chocolate, and espresso. The finish is long, clean, supple, and packed with sweet, ripe, juicy fruits. This is among the best vintages of Feytit Clinet ever produced. The wine blends 90% Merlot with 10% Cabernet Franc. Drink from 2029-2055."
